chickenmobile

2010-10-26 02:32:34

the_big_cheese wrote:
chickenmobile wrote:the scroll wheel broke and got stuck in hyper scroll. I had it only for a month and I was distraught. Not thinking about complaining to Logitech and getting another one I Disassembled the mouse and fixed it
What was wrong with it/ how did you fix it?
The spring that holds the thing that makes it click when you scroll had broken in once place and was just jiggling around with no purpose. I took off the broken spring, got a pair of pliers and a soldering iron and bent the spring so it fit back onto the place it should.

PLEASE NOTE THAT PULLING OFF THE SLICK PADS ON THE BOTTOM OF THE MOUSE TO UNSCREW IT APART WILL VOID YOUR WARRANTY. That's if you have one :)
